Are there any incentives for communities to report improper use or vandalism of the bin?

Communities play a vital role in maintaining clean and sustainable environments, and reporting improper use or vandalism of bins is a key part of this effort. Many local governments and organizations offer incentives to encourage such reporting, recognizing its importance in waste management.

Common incentives include financial rewards, community recognition, or even tax deductions for those who report misuse. Some areas provide points-based systems where residents can earn discounts on local services or waste collection fees. These programs not only deter vandalism but also foster a sense of shared responsibility.

Beyond tangible rewards, reporting improper bin use helps reduce contamination in recycling streams, lowers cleanup costs, and promotes environmental awareness. Communities with active reporting systems often see fewer incidents of illegal dumping and better overall waste management.

By participating, residents contribute to a cleaner neighborhood while potentially benefiting from incentives—a win-win for both the community and the environment.
